Welcome to the bombcell 💣 wiki!

Bombcell is a powerful toolbox designed to evaluate the quality of recorded units and extract essential electrophysiological properties. It is specifically tailored for units recorded with Neuropixel probes (3A, 1.0, and 2.0) using SpikeGLX or OpenEphys and spike-sorted with Kilosort.
